Accountants who specialize …Oct 6, 2023 · A major differs from an undergraduate degree in the number of college credits that are required for completion. A major usually requires about 36 credits depending on the requirements of each university. A college degree such as a bachelor’s degree is usually 120 credits, which includes the 36 credits of your major along with additional ... The Management program aims to prepare students for positions of leadership and responsibility in contemporary organizations. To take a leading management ...Oct 13, 2023 · What is Management? Management is the art and science of efficiently coordinating and directing human and material resources toward attaining organizational goals. It comprises a wide range of activities, including planning, organizing, leading, and controlling, collectively forming the pillars of effective management. Jul 27, 2023 · Management information systems degrees are often confused with computer science degrees due to similar coursework. Both MIS and computer science degree programs include the study of computer-based information systems. However, MIS degree programs focus more heavily on business database systems, business systems analysis, and administration.
